This month, I had a wonderful moment taking a business class with our founder, Aviv, who shared an amazing topic about core values and life purpose. To make the class more engaging and effective, everyone was required to do a pre-assignment beforehand to ensure we could deeply understand the definition of values and also find and understand our five core values and our own life purpose. During class, we had many activities such as sharing our ideas related to each topic, and particularly, we also had case studies and group decisions in which we needed to use critical thinking, and some seemed to reflect our real conditions in the NGO and our studies. I was so grateful and thankful to our founder for his time and to the BC team, who were well prepared to make the class run smoothly and productively.

For my community volunteer work, I also joined an FS activity in Bakong District. During this activity, I recently visited two families. One was an elderly family, and the other was a divorced family living with two children who deeply value their education. Whenever I visit them, I feel emotional, thankful, and full of gratitude for everything I have. I realize how fortunate I am to have a warm family, supportive mentors, and opportunities to build my capacity through work experience and pursue my education at PUC. Joining this activity has motivated me a lot. Seeing people who live in much harder conditions than me, yet never doubt their ability to continue learning and pursuing their dreams and life purpose, truly inspires me. Moreover, I also shared my own life journey with them in order to encourage and inspire them through my volunteering experiences and my education journey in both NGO work and university life.
